1920's Ansco No. 2A Buster Brown Box Camera

$30 USD1920's Ansco No. 2A Buster Brown Box Camera

Collectibles:Photographic:Camera:Ansco
1920's Ansco No. 2A Buster Brown Box Camera No matter how you count the history of this old camera, it is nearly 90 years old! First patented in 1903, revised in 1910 and again in 1916, it was popularly sold through the 1920's. The outside case of the camera is made of wood covered with a thin leather material. Vintage Airguide Barometer Better Than The Weatherman

$40 USDVintage Airguide Barometer Better Than The Weatherman

Collectibles:Instruments:Airguide:Barometer
At least it’s better than our weatherman! Designed in the fashion of a ship’s wheel, this desktop model was made by the Airguide Instrument Co., formerly of Chicago. Originally name the Fee and Stemwedel Co., they were widely acclaimed for producing excellent quality barometers, hydrometers, thermometers, compasses, and binoculars used in homes, boats, and even cars.
